UKGC Rules and Why They Matter for Your Bankroll

You might think a license is boring. It is not. It is the only thing stopping the casino from rigging the game. In the UK, the UK Gambling Commission (UKGC) is strict. They force casinos to publish their RTPs. If a casino doesn’t show you the RTP for their live blackjack tables, walk away. It is a red flag.

I have seen some operators try to sneak in lower payouts. For example, a standard blackjack pays 3:2. Some tables will try to pay 6:5. That tiny change increases the house edge by about 1.4%. Over a 100-hand session, that is a massive difference. Always check the table rules before you sit down. Look for the little icon that says ‘Blackjack pays 3:2’. If it says 6:5, do not play. It is not worth it.

Also, be aware of the ‘Early Payout’ or ‘Surrender’ options. Some live tables offer them. They can be useful if you have a terrible hand, but they are not always the optimal play. I usually stick to basic strategy. There are plenty of charts online. Print one out. Keep it next to your monitor. It is not cheating. It is just playing the game correctly.

What is the RTP for live blackjack in the UK?

The RTP is typically between 99.4% and 99.6% for standard blackjack with 3:2 payouts. If the table uses 6:5 payouts, the RTP drops to around 98%. Always check the specific table rules. The casino should display this information in the game lobby.

Is there a difference between ‘Speed Blackjack’ and ‘Classic Blackjack’?

Yes. Speed Blackjack deals the cards to each player individually. You make your decision without waiting for the rest of the table. Classic Blackjack deals to the whole table at once. Speed is faster, which means you see more hands per hour. That can be good or bad depending on your bankroll. I prefer Speed when I am on a hot streak.
